Why I Focus On The Whole Person And Not Numbers...
My philosophy in treating all my clients is to focus on establishing a healthier relationship with food. Achieving healthier relationships with food is attainable through a combination of nutrition education and evidence based therapies utilizing my dual credentials in dietetics and professional counseling. I customize nutrition therapy for each individual utilizing my preferred cognitive behavioral therapy and mindful/conscious/intuitive eating modalities that focus on mental perception and awareness. This means I work on finding cognitive distortions in thinking and habits that influence eating behaviors. Cognitive distortions are held sacred for their guidelines for behavior to gain a sense of safety, control, and identity. I work on challenging these distortions in both an educational and empathic way to avoid unnecessary power struggles. I remind my clients that it is ultimately their choice but that their disordered eating self urges them to act on false, incorrect, or misleading information and faulty assumptions due to cognitive distortions. I have found that my clients establish weight-related behaviors due to a set of beliefs, attitudes, and assumptions about the meaning of eating and body weight. I challenge disordered attitudes and beliefs as to interrupt and eventually stop the disordered eating behaviors. This establishes optimal health with a health at every size approach.
In addition, I work with my clients to ensure they learn what adaptive functions or disordered eating behaviors they are using and work through them to help internalize the ability to attain and maintain recovery. I educate them that their disordered behaviors are used to express inner self struggles and that by working through their underlying issues and resolving them their disordered eating behaviors will decrease and a healthier self will arise.
